Humanoid HMND 01 targeted at range of use cases

In Feb. 2025, AI and robotics startup Humanoid published a video of its HMND 01 general-purpose humanoid robot in action. The U.K.-based company aims to develop commercially scalable and safe humanoid robots. The HMND 01 features modular hardware and software, as well as a range of interchangeable garments to protect the robot and its working environment. Humanoid said applications for its robot include retail, manufacturing, and supply chain use cases such as materials handling, picking, packing, and kitting.
